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- Generally, the polishing of metal is important for appearance or clean-room application. It is one of the most favored procedures simply because of its use in improving the overall attractiveness of the product, for instance, motor bike parts, kitchenware or vehicle parts. Similarly, a good number of clean-rooms call for a polished finish in order to reduce the porosity of the material that may result in particles to collect and contaminate. A superb illustration of this application might be in vacuum chambers.

There are a good number of strategies to finish metals, and we can look into examples of the processes required. Metal can be polished utilising chemicals,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, and even by hand. A buffing compound or paste is regularly applied, that may consist of d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, rather high viscosity, and hardness is often one of the most time-consuming. Then again, merchandise made out of non-ferrous metals are certainly more responsive to buffing, simply because these need the lower amount of operations.

A lesser pad speed is commonly employed in the event that a high quality mirror finish is vital. Polishing buffs covered with compound can be very much affected by the pressures on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be elevated to a specified scope, having said that, further overreaching the appropriate amount of load not merely cuts down on the quality of treatment, but in addition can degrade efficiency, causes wear to the component, plus there is additionally an evident heating of the pieces being worked on, as a result of friction. When you are using thin metal, it is increased temperature (and a relating flexibility of the metal) that can cause components to flex, buckle or warp. In general, it will take a seasoned technician to consider every one of these things to both avert damage to the workpiece and to get the project done correctly. To help you substantially enhance the quality of the finished finish, the polishing operation needs to be accomplished with much less vigour and not a large amount of force in an effort to in time complete a surface that is free of scratches or fine lines brought about by the polishing procedure, therefore ar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
